Lady Behave

…A young and irresponsible girl named Clarice goes out to the Mardi Gras celebration and comes home drunk the next morning, announcing that she got married last night. Her sister Paula reminds her that she was already married but Clarice has a hard time understanding the gravity of the situation she is in. It’s up to Paula to come up with a scheme that will get one of Clarice’s marriages annulled before she is given 10 years in prison for bigamy….

Of Human Bondage

…Philip Carey is a failed artist who has returned from France to start a medical career in London. He meets a girl who works as a waitress, Mildred Rogers, and quickly falls in love with her. Mildred however only responds with deception and betrayal. How far will she go until Philip realizes that he is looking for love in the wrong place?…

Buster Keaton: The General

…Johnnie Gray tries to enlist with the Confederate Army in the beginning of the American Civil War, but is rejected because his job is a train engineer and he is much needed during the war. His girlfriend assumes that he didn’t want to support the Confederacy and refuses to ever speak to him again. It so happens that Johnnie’s train, The General, is hijacked by the Union and he finally gets a chance to show what he’s really worth!…
